In the world of sales and marketing, telemarketing plays a vital role in connecting businesses with potential customers. Despite the rise of digital marketing strategies, telemarketing remains a valuable tool for reaching out to prospects and generating leads. This form of direct marketing involves contacting potential customers via telephone to promote products or services, conduct surveys, arrange appointments, or gather information. With the right approach, telemarketing can be a highly effective and cost-efficient way to boost sales and grow a business.

telemarketing allows businesses to have direct communication with their target audience, which can be more personal and engaging than other forms of advertising. By speaking directly to prospects, telemarketers can tailor their message to suit the individual needs and preferences of each potential customer. This personalized approach can help build rapport and trust, ultimately leading to higher conversion rates.

One of the key advantages of telemarketing is its ability to generate immediate feedback. Unlike other marketing strategies that may take weeks or even months to see results, telemarketing offers instant gratification. By engaging in real-time conversations with prospects, businesses can quickly gauge their level of interest and address any concerns or objections on the spot. This immediate feedback can be invaluable in refining sales pitches, identifying customer needs, and adjusting marketing strategies to better target the desired audience.

telemarketing also gives businesses the opportunity to reach a large number of prospects in a short amount of time. With a well-organized telemarketing campaign, companies can make hundreds or even thousands of calls in a single day, significantly increasing their chances of finding qualified leads. This efficiency not only saves time and resources but also allows businesses to quickly adapt to changing market conditions and seize new opportunities as they arise.

Furthermore, telemarketing is a versatile tool that can be used in a variety of ways to achieve different objectives. Beyond traditional cold calling, telemarketing can be utilized for customer retention, market research, appointment setting, and event promotion. By diversifying their telemarketing efforts, businesses can maximize their outreach and engage with customers at various stages of the sales cycle.

Despite its many benefits, telemarketing is not without its challenges. One of the main criticisms of telemarketing is the negative stigma associated with unsolicited calls. Many consumers view telemarketing as intrusive and annoying, leading to a decline in response rates and an increase in regulatory restrictions. To overcome this obstacle, businesses must adopt ethical telemarketing practices, such as obtaining prior consent from prospects, respecting their privacy preferences, and providing clear opt-out options.

Additionally, the success of a telemarketing campaign relies heavily on the skills and training of the telemarketers themselves. Effective telemarketers must possess strong communication skills, persuasive abilities, and a thorough understanding of the products or services they are promoting. Providing ongoing training and support to telemarketing staff is essential to ensure that they are equipped to represent the company in a professional and convincing manner.

In today’s digital age, telemarketing continues to evolve with advancements in technology and changing consumer behaviors. Automated dialing systems, customer relationship management (CRM) software, and data analytics tools have revolutionized the way telemarketing is conducted, making it more efficient and targeted than ever before. Businesses can now leverage these technological innovations to streamline their telemarketing processes, track performance metrics, and optimize their campaigns for greater success.
